Types of Degrees Other Health/Medical Admin Services Majors Are Getting
The following table lists how many other health and medical administrative services graduations there were in 2020-2021 for each degree level.
Education Level | Number of Grads |
---|---|
Bachelor’s Degree | 589 |
Associate Degree | 536 |
Undergraduate Certificate | 397 |
Basic Certificate | 348 |

Online Other Health/Medical Admin Services Programs
In the 2020-2021 academic year, 121 schools offered some type of other health and medical administrative services program. The following table lists the number of programs by degree level, along with how many schools offered online courses in the field.
Degree Level | Colleges Offering Programs | Colleges Offering Online Classes |
---|---|---|
Certificate (Less Than 1 Year) | 0 | 0 |
Certificate (1-2 years) | 18 | 6 |
Certificate (2-4 Years) | 0 | 0 |
Associate’s Degree | 32 | 10 |
Bachelor’s Degree | 14 | 4 |
Post-Baccalaureate | 0 | 0 |
Master’s Degree | 15 | 4 |
Post-Master’s | 0 | 0 |
Doctor’s Degree (Research) | 2 | 0 |
Doctor’s Degree (Professional Practice) | 0 | 0 |
Doctor’s Degree (Other) | 0 | 0 |
